Calming Collars

First, calming collars are infused with pheromones or essential oils known for their soothing properties. These collars provide a continuous, gentle release of calming scents, helping to create a serene environment for your furry friend. Consider trying collars infused with lavender, chamomile, or pheromones that mimic a mother dog’s calming scent!

Thundershirts

Thundershirts are like cozy, snug blankets for your dog! These compression garments apply gentle, constant pressure to your pup’s torso, creating a calming effect similar to swaddling a baby. Thundershirts are especially beneficial during thunderstorms, fireworks, or other anxiety-inducing situations.

Calming Treats

Next, dog-friendly treats infused with calming ingredients, such as chamomile, valerian root, or CBD, are an excellent way to alleviate stress! These tasty morsels not only provide a delicious distraction but also contribute to a sense of relaxation for your pup. Always consult your veterinarian before introducing new treats into your dog’s diet.

Soothing Music and Pheromone Diffusers

Create a calming atmosphere at home by playing soothing music designed for furry friends. Additionally, pheromone diffusers release synthetic canine pheromones that mimic dogs’ natural calming signals. These diffusers can be plugged into wall outlets, providing comfort in your dog’s living space!

Interactive Toys

Lastly, keep your pup engaged and distracted with interactive toys that dispense treats! This provides mental stimulation and encourages a sense of accomplishment, diverting attention from stressors. Puzzle toys or treat-dispensing balls can also be particularly effective in keeping your dog’s mind engaged!
